WebHailed by Ansel Adams as “the greatest photographer of the nude,” Ruth Bernhard is known for her sensual yet reserved nudes, still lifes, and photographs of natural forms. After studying art history and typography at the Berlin Academy of Art, in 1927 Bernhard moved to New York where she worked as a photographer’s assistant for a magazine. ( 6 ) $33.25. How the practice of titling paintings has shaped their reception throughout modern history. A picture's title is often our first guide to understanding the image. Yet paintings didn’t always have titles, and many canvases acquired their names from curators, dealers, and printmakers—not the artists. mameli nome
